Halftime Stats:

Passing: Shaub 11/16 97 yds, 1 TD; Orlovsky 2/3 29 yds, 1 INT

Rushing: Slaton 6/30, Brown 4/5

Receiving: AJ 4/38, many with 2 catches

Tackles: Ryans 6, M. Williams/Wilson/Quin 4

Time of Possession: Texans 15:02, Saints 14:58
